Superstition






SUPERSTITION

UK, 2001, 95 minutes, Colour.
Mark Strong, Sienna Guilleroy, David Warner, Charlotte Rampling, Alice Kriger, Frances Barber, Derek Delint.
Directed by Kenneth Hope.

Superstition is an odd supernatural thriller. While most of the cast is British, the setting is Italy and the characters Italian.

The film focuses on a young girl who seems to have telekinetic powers involved in fire. It emerges that she has inherited this from her family. However, when a child is killed in the house burning down, she is accused of murder. The woman herself (Sienna Guilleroy) is confused. She is supported by her lawyer, Mark Strong (an actor on the British stage and a character actor in films, with powerful performances in such films as Revolver and as the assassin in Syriana). Charlotte Rampling appears as a psychologist nun – rather modern in style, except that the community is a touch old-fashioned. Alice Kriger and Derek Delint are the parents of the dead child, David Warner is the judge.

The film involves on-site testing of the girl’s powers, prison sequences, the court case itself, the interrogations by authorities, the discussions with the psychologist nun.

The film is intriguing in its way – but a bit too British to be effective as an Italian story.
